6. Maintenance ( perawatan ) , menangani per angkat lunak yang sudah
selesai supaya dapat berjalan lancar dan ter hindar dari gangguan-
gangguan yang dapat menyebabkan kerusakan.
2.8 Pemrograman Berorientasi Objek
Object-Oriented Programming (OOP) adalah sebuah pendekatan untuk
pengembangan suatu Software dimana dalam struktur Software tersebut didasarkan
kepada interaksi object dalam penyelesaian suatu proses/tugas.
Berikut beberapa konsep dasar dan term-term yang umum untuk seluruh
bahasa Object Oriented Programing :
1. Encapsulation atau pemodelan
Encapsulation adalah konsep penggabungan data dengan operator.Dalam
konsep pemodelan data dan operasi menjadi satu kasatuan yan g disebut
object.Encapsulation juga disebut dengan penyembun yian informasi
(information hiding).
2. Inheritance atau penurunan
Inheritance adalah
sebuah objek yan g dapat diturunkan menjadi objek
yang baru dengan tidak menghilangkan sifat asli dari objek tersebut.
3. Polymorphism atau Polimorfisme
Polymorphism merupakan penggunaan sebagai macam objek yang
berbeda tetapi secara fungsi bergantung pada satu objek sebagai induk,
dengan cara pelaksanaan yan g b erbeda-b eda.
2.9 Borland Delphi
Delphi adalah sebuah bahasa pemrograman visual di lingkungan windows (
under windows) yang menggunakan bahasa pascal sebagai Compiler. Penggunaan
delphi dapat mempersingkat waktu pemrograman, karena programmer tidak perlu
lagi menuliskan kode program yang rumit dan panjang untuk menggambar,
meletakkan dan mengatur komponen. Delphi menyediakan cukup banyak pilihan
komponen interf ace aplikasi, antara lain berupa tombol menu, drop down, ataupun
menu pop up, kotak text, radio button, check box , dan sebagainya. Bahkan ada
berbagai macam komponen Skin tampilan yang beragam yang disediakan oleh
|